Optimize Your Urban Garden: Powerful Container Gardening Tips
In the realm of urban gardening, every square inch matters. Optimizing your compact garden design with strategic container gardening tips can transform a modest outdoor space into a vibrant oasis. For instance, placing a small tree or feature plant in a stylish pot can instantly become the focal point of your balcony garden design or tiny garden landscaping. This simple yet effective technique not only adds aesthetic appeal but also provides a sense of tranquility and connection to nature, even in the hustle and bustle of city living.
Consider vertical gardening ideas for maximizing space in your modern small garden. By stacking pots on different levels, you can create depth and dimension while ensuring each plant gets adequate sunlight and nutrients. For example, a combination of tall, slender plants like bamboo or arborvitae at the back, complemented by smaller, trailing plants like petunias or geraniums in front, can produce a stunning visual effect. This approach not only saves space but also simplifies maintenance, making your urban garden both beautiful and low-maintenance.
Successful Tiny Landscaping: Advanced Balcony Garden Ideas
In the realm of urban gardening, where every square inch is precious, creating a captivating focal point in a small garden design can transform a mundane outdoor space into a vibrant and inviting oasis. The key lies in strategic placement and creative use of compact garden ideas. For instance, a miniature tree, such as a dwarf variety or an indoor plant adapted to outdoor life, can serve as the centerpiece, offering both aesthetic appeal and a connection to nature. Accompanying this feature with a well-curated selection of space-saving plants in container gardening setups creates depth and visual interest, enhancing the overall ambiance.
Vertical gardening ideas are another excellent strategy for tiny garden landscaping. By utilizing vertical spaces, such as walls or fences, gardeners can expand their small garden design potential. This approach not only conserves floor space but also adds a modern aesthetic. For example, a balcony garden design might feature a series of elevated beds or hanging planters, allowing for a diverse range of plants in a compact setting.
